Jung Kyung-ho tackles heavy themes in ‘Oh My Ghost Clients’ as episode 4 airs.

Actor Jung Kyung-ho is stepping up his game in ‘Oh My Ghost Clients.’ In the June 7 broadcast, his character, labor attorney No Mu-jin, faces a gripping case involving a rookie nurse who died under mysterious circumstances.

Mu-jin starts indifferent but grows more invested as he uncovers the truth behind nurse Jo Eun-young‘s suspicious death. Initially dismissed as a suicide, Eun-young’s story takes a darker turn as Mu-jin’s team digs deeper into potential medical malpractice.

A standout moment? Nurse Go Kyun-woo, played by Cha Hak-yeon, infiltrates the hospital disguised as a doctor. His discovery of hidden documents fuels a tense rooftop chase, culminating in a dramatic moment where he saves the nurse who bullied Eun-young.

"If you’re sorry, speak the truth. Apologize while you’re alive," urges the spirit of Eun-young, channelled through Mu-jin as he confronts the guilt-ridden nurse. The confrontation turns emotional, showcasing the show’s powerful themes.

The episode ends with the trio releasing a tell-all on their channel ‘Gyun-jjang TV,’ which quickly goes viral. The video not only clears Eun-young’s name but also sheds light on the toxic culture within the hospital.

The gripping story concludes with a touching memorial scene for Eun-young. As her spirit departs, Mu-jin’s transformation from a cold attorney to a compassionate advocate is made clear.
